Poisson s Ration n (for S. Poisson symbol p or v) In a material under tensile stress, the ratio of the transverse contraction to the longitudinal elongation. For metals, Poisson s ratio is bout 0.3, for concrete, 0.1. For many... [Pg.546]

When a material is stretched, one of the dimensions increases and the other two will decrease. The ratio between the changes in the linear strain produced in the perpendicular direction (Cp, ), due to the tensile stress producing the tensile strain (e), is called the Poisson s ration (w), and is defined by ... [Pg.178]

For the simulation of isotropic thermoplastics elasto-viscoplastic material models are used. They are composed of an elastic part consisting of a constant Young s modulus and Poisson s ration and a plastic part being described by true stress/strain-curves depending on the true plastic strain-rate. As a failure criterion a maximal endurable hydrostatic stress, a critical equivalent plastic strain or a combination of these can be used. The strain criterion can also be set as a function of the strain-rate. [Pg.1020]

Pipe strain is a function of pipe wall thickness, pipe diameter, Poisson s ration for the pipe material, and the mounting conditions. Mounting conditions include how the ends of the pipe are constrained, fixed or free. The wave speed of the polymer, a, is adjusted to account for the calculated effect of fte pipe strain [4.] Also, forces on the flow in the pipe include inlet and exit pressures, inertia, and viscous friction. [Pg.3057]
